William Notman

William Notman was a Canadian photographer, businessperson and entrepreneur (1826–1891). He was born at Paisley and died at Montreal.

Identity and origins

William Notman was recorded at birth as William McFarlane Notman. The authorities additionally record the headings W. Notman and Wm. Notman. His recorded language was English.

2 children are recorded: William McFarlane Notman and Charles Notman.

Career and activity

Recorded position is Member of the Legislative Assembly of the Province of Canada. He worked at Montreal, Cambridge, Philadelphia, Ottawa and Canada.

Recognition and collections

William Notman received Person of National Historic Significance. Work by William Notman is held by National Gallery of Canada, Smithsonian American Art Museum, Notman Photographic Archives and J. Paul Getty Museum.
